Abstract

The utility model discloses a storage drawer box based on high-transparency integrated high polymer materials, which comprises a drawer box main body, a plurality of obliquely arranged partition plates are arranged on the drawer box main body, a first containing cavity is formed between the lowest partition plate and the drawer box main body, a second containing cavity is formed between every two adjacent partition plates, and the first containing cavity is communicated with the second containing cavity. A drawer main body is arranged in the second accommodating cavity; a first supporting plate is integrally formed at the bottom of the drawer body located on the inner side of the second containing cavity, a second supporting plate is integrally formed at the bottom of the other side of the bottom of the drawer body, an extension plate is integrally formed at the top of the drawer body, and a notch is formed in the second supporting plate. At least one wedge-shaped groove is formed in the bottom of the drawer body at the notch so that the drawer body can be pulled out conveniently. The storage box is simple in structure, not only can realize privacy storage of articles, but also can realize display of the placed articles or is convenient for searching of the placed articles due to the fact that the storage box is made of high-transparency materials, and is suitable for use environments with small spaces.

Technical Field

[0001] The utility model belongs to the technical field of containers, and in particular relates to a storage drawer box based on highly transparent integrated polymer materials. Background Art

[0002] A drawer-type storage box includes an outer shell and an inner box body. The inner box body has an opening at the top and is mounted in the outer shell. The inner box body matches the outer shell and can slide relative to the outer shell. The inner box body is used to hold objects (such as stationery, keys, tissues, and other small items). The outer shell surrounds the inner box body to prevent the objects in the inner box from falling. The portable folding tissue box disclosed in Chinese utility model patent specification CN2308328Y consists of a protective shell (i.e., the outer shell) and a paper trough (equivalent to the inner box body). However, existing storage drawer boxes are mostly opaque structures, making it difficult to accurately lock the items stored inside. Multiple drawers are often required to find them, and they are not suitable for environments with limited space. Therefore, it is very important to obtain a storage drawer box based on a highly transparent integrated polymer material that overcomes the above-mentioned shortcomings. Utility Model Content

[0003] To solve at least one of the above technical problems, the present invention provides a storage drawer box based on a highly transparent integrated polymer material, comprising a drawer box body, wherein a plurality of obliquely arranged partitions are provided on the drawer box body, a first accommodating cavity is formed between the bottommost partition and the drawer box body, and a second accommodating cavity is formed between two adjacent partitions, wherein the drawer body is disposed in the second accommodating cavity;

[0004] A first support plate is integrally formed at the bottom of the drawer body located inside the second accommodating cavity, a second support plate is integrally formed at the bottom on the other side of the bottom of the drawer body, and an extension plate is integrally formed at the top, a notch is provided on the second support plate, and at least one wedge-shaped groove is provided on the bottom of the drawer body at the notch to facilitate pulling out the drawer body.

[0005] Through the above technical solution, the partition of the utility model is arranged obliquely, which is more suitable for occasions where the space is small, such as a small house used as a cabinet or wardrobe.

[0006] The setting of the notch allows you to insert your finger when you need to open the drawer, and then hold the wedge-shaped groove with your finger to pull it out. Alternatively, there are several wedge-shaped grooves to increase friction, and the drawer box body can be pulled out through static friction between the fingertips and the wedge-shaped grooves.

[0007] As a preferred embodiment of the above, limiting rods are transversely fixedly installed on the inner walls of both sides of the second accommodating cavity, and limiting grooves cooperating with the limiting rods are formed between the first support plate and the second support plate.

[0008] Through the above technical solution, the setting of the limiting rod and the limiting groove can prevent the drawer body from falling out and injuring the feet.

[0009] As a preferred embodiment of the above, a limiting block cooperating with the drawer body is provided on the top of the second accommodating cavity.

[0010] Through the above technical solution, the setting of the limit block can further prevent the drawer body from falling out.

[0011] As a preferred embodiment of the above, the upper surface of the limiting rod is flush with the lowest end of the opening of the second accommodating cavity.

[0012] Through the above technical solution, the lowest end of the opening and the upper surface of the limiting rod support the drawer body so that it is in a horizontal state.

[0013] As a preferred embodiment of the above, the drawer box body and the drawer body are both made of highly transparent materials, and slots are provided on the four walls of the drawer box body, into which decorative paper can be inserted.

[0014] Through the above technical solution, the highly transparent material can be inserted with decorative paper, which can increase the privacy of the interior according to the user's preference. Without inserting the decorative paper, the display function can be realized.

[0015] As a preferred embodiment of the above, the top of the uppermost partition is a plane, and the plane has fixed panels on at least four sides.

[0016] Compared with the prior art, the beneficial effects of the present invention are: the present invention has a simple structure, which not only enables private storage of items, but also, because the present invention adopts highly transparent materials, it can display the placed items or facilitate the search of the placed items, and is suitable for use in smaller spaces.
